Inversion of Weinstein intertwining operator and its dual using Weinstein wavelets

In this paper, we consider the Weinstein intertwining operator ℜa, dW and its dual tR a,dW. Using these operators, we give relations between the Weinstein and the classical continuous wavelet transforms.
